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Layout methodology that automates layout rule verification for differential signal trace pairs

A differential signal and layout method technology, applied in special data processing applications, instruments, electrical digital data processing, etc., can solve problems such as poor quality of printed circuit boards and reduce the work efficiency of layout engineers

Inactive Publication Date: 2011-12-07
嘉兴金日升工具股份有限公司
View PDF0 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] The purpose of the present invention is to provide a layout method that can automatically perform the layout rule inspection of differential signal wiring pairs, so as to solve the problem that the conventional layout method is easy to be artificial due to manually confirming the layout rules of differential signal wiring pairs. Negligence, which leads to poor quality of the designed printed circuit board, and avoids reducing the work efficiency of the layout engineer due to human operation

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Layout methodology that automates layout rule verification for differential signal trace pairs
  • Layout methodology that automates layout rule verification for differential signal trace pairs
  • Layout methodology that automates layout rule verification for differential signal trace pairs

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0016] In order to facilitate the comparison with the conventional layout method and make it easier for readers to understand the present invention, the following embodiments will first assume that there is already a layout software that uses a program based on the layout method of the present invention, and will also be combined with the accompanying drawings. The present invention will be described in detail.

[0017] Assuming that a layout engineer is using this layout software, in the process of operation, the layout software will determine whether the layout engineer further requires automatic execution of the layout rule verification operation of the differential signal wiring pair. If the judgment is yes, the layout software will execute the aforementioned program based on the layout method of the present invention to automatically execute the layout rule verification of the differential signal wiring pair. The layout software automatically executes the layout rule check o...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A layout method that automates layout rule verification for differential signal trace pairs. The method includes the following steps: a. Obtain the name and center coordinates of each signal line in a differential signal line pair from a line data. b. Obtain line width data and line spacing data of each of the above signal lines from a network type data according to the names of the above signal lines. c. According to the obtained trace center coordinates and trace width data, it is judged whether each pair of parallel line segments in the differential signal trace pair does not conform to the trace distance contained in the trace data. d. Calculate the length of the above-mentioned signal traces according to the obtained trace center coordinates, so as to determine whether the length difference of the signal traces in the differential signal trace pair is within an allowable error range. e. According to the coordinates of the above-mentioned routing centers, it is judged whether the same pair of parallel line segments is sandwiched by two copper-laying areas for supplying different power types in the differential signal routing pairs.

Description

Technical field [0001] The present invention relates to a technology in the field of layout, in particular to a layout method. Background technique [0002] In the production of Printed Circuit Board (PCB), in the layout of multilayer boards, traces are often used to travel in different layers through vias. , In order to connect the components placed on the two surfaces of the circuit board, or connect the components on the surface of the circuit board to the power copper area of ​​the inner layer of the circuit board. figure 1 It is a schematic diagram of routing through through holes. Such as figure 1 As shown, this circuit board is divided into eight layers for wiring, which are labeled L1 to L8, respectively, and the wiring 102 connects the components 106 and 108 through through holes (as shown by the label 104). [0003] In some special circuit designs, differential traces are used for layout. The differential signal trace pair is a very special signal in a printed circuit b...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F17/50
Inventor 张有权阮于绫林明慧
Owner 嘉兴金日升工具股份有限公司
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products